John Harbaugh Interviews Jaxson Dart in Wednesday Meeting with Giants
The New York Giants are actively involving their young quarterback, Jaxson Dart, in their search for a new head coach. John Harbaugh, currently under consideration for the position, met with Dart during his interview with the team on Wednesday.
Jaxson Dart’s Promising Rookie Season
Jaxson Dart, the 25th overall pick in the 2025 NFL Draft, had a notable debut season. Over 14 games, he secured 12 starts. Dart completed 63.7% of his passes, accumulating 2,272 yards. He threw for 15 touchdown passes and had five interceptions.
Despite facing multiple injuries and being evaluated for concussions throughout the season, Dart showcased significant potential. His performance indicates that he can be a valuable asset for the Giants’ ongoing and future endeavors.

John Harbaugh’s Coaching Interviews
The Giants have interviewed multiple candidates as part of the Rooney Rule compliance. They are poised to hire John Harbaugh at any time after these interviews. Reports suggest Harbaugh is also considering head coaching opportunities with the Tennessee Titans and Atlanta Falcons this week.
